ฉันต้องใช้รหัสผ่านเพื่อป้องกันไฟล์ PDF ของฉันเพราะฉันจะส่งพวกเขาทางอีเมลและฉันต้องการใครก็ตามที่จะดูไฟล์ PDF ของฉันเพื่อขอรหัสผ่าน
ฉันจะเพิ่มรหัสผ่านลงใน PDF ใน Linux Mint 17.1 ได้อย่างไร
ฉันต้องใช้รหัสผ่านเพื่อป้องกันไฟล์ PDF ของฉันเพราะฉันจะส่งพวกเขาทางอีเมลและฉันต้องการใครก็ตามที่จะดูไฟล์ PDF ของฉันเพื่อขอรหัสผ่าน
ฉันจะเพิ่มรหัสผ่านลงใน PDF ใน Linux Mint 17.1 ได้อย่างไร
คำตอบ:
คุณสามารถใช้โปรแกรมpdftk
เพื่อตั้งค่าทั้งเจ้าของและ / หรือรหัสผ่านผู้ใช้
pdftk input.pdf output output.pdf owner_pw xyz user_pw abc
โดยที่owner_pw
และuser_pw
เป็นคำสั่งเพื่อเพิ่มรหัสผ่านxyz
และabc
ตามลำดับ (คุณยังสามารถระบุหนึ่งหรืออื่น ๆ แต่user_pw
จำเป็นต้องห้ามเพื่อเปิด)
คุณอาจต้องการแทนที่ความแรงของการเข้ารหัส 40 บิตเริ่มต้นด้วยการเพิ่ม:
.... encrypt_128bit
pdftk ขึ้นอยู่กับไลบรารีเก่าและไม่อยู่ใน repos ของ Fedora / CentOS อีกต่อไป เพื่อทดแทนฉันชอบ qpdf
qpdf --encrypt [readpass] [ownerpass] 256 - [infile] .pdf [outfile] .pdf
ชุดเครื่องมือ pdftk ช่วยให้การทำงานประเภทนี้บน Linux
open your Ubuntu Terminal [CTRL+ALT+T] install pdftk by using this command : sudo apt-get install pdftk make sure pdftk is now installed by write this on terminal : pdftk you will see a bunch of pdftk command instructions if it already installed simply using this command to add a password to your existing pdf document
pdftk <source>.pdf output <destination>.pdf userpw <password>
example:
pdftk Mydocs.pdf output Mydocs_pass.pdf userpw secretword
http://wildabdat.tumblr.com/post/13245065154/how-to-add-password-to-your-pdf-docs-on-ubuntu
คุณยังสามารถส่งออกไฟล์ PDF ที่เข้ารหัสจาก Libre Office (ไฟล์ -> ส่งออกเป็น PDF -> แท็บความปลอดภัย -> ตั้งรหัสผ่าน -> ตั้งรหัสผ่านเปิด) หากจำเป็นต้องนำเข้าไฟล์ PDF ที่มีอยู่ของคุณลงในโปรแกรมวาดภาพก่อน
การใช้เครื่องมือจาก Poppler Toolset (จากแพคเกจเหมือนlibpoppler
หรือpoppler-tools
) คุณสามารถบรรลุเป้าหมายนี้ด้วยการรวมกันของและpdftops
ps2pdf
pdftops in.pdf out.ps
ps2pdf -sUserPassword=XXXXX -sOwnerPassword=YYYYY out.ps out.pdf
โปรดทราบว่าในการตั้งรหัสผ่านผู้ใช้ (มุมมอง) คุณต้องตั้งรหัสผ่านเจ้าของ (แก้ไข)
บน Fedora คุณสามารถใช้pdf-staplerเพื่อตั้งรหัสผ่านสำหรับไฟล์ PDF และดำเนินการคล้ายกับ pdftk อื่น ๆ
ตัวอย่างการตั้งรหัสผ่านผู้ใช้ (รหัสที่จำเป็นสำหรับการเปิดไฟล์):
pdf-stapler -u QRNFFtVXA-8PqF cat input_file.pdf output_file.pdf
นี่เป็นรหัสผ่านที่คุณคิดว่าเป็นไปได้มากที่สุดเกี่ยวกับการตั้งรหัสผ่านเป็นไฟล์ PDF
ในกรณีที่คุณต้องการตั้งรหัสผ่านเจ้าของ (รหัสที่กำหนดสิทธิ์เช่นการพิมพ์การแสดงความคิดเห็นและอื่น ๆ ) ให้ใช้-o
ตัวเลือก
pdftk 2.02-2
)